ABC7:

The first fire trucks were dispatched at 1:07 in the morning.

“Structure fire reported 27 Grand Street,” dispatch said.

But that’s the wrong address. The fire is actually nearly three miles away at 28 Grant Avenue. When fire trucks arrived to an empty lot, they radioed back.

“Dispatch from Engine 2, can I have an address check please?” the fire truck said.

More than three minutes passed as the fire was spreading rapidly through the wood frame homes before the mistake was figured out and first responders got a correct address.

“All units redirect to 27 Grant with a T, Grant with a T Avenue,” dispatch said.

This fire dispatch document shows the first engines arrived at the raging fire nearly 8 minutes after the first call.
